What Are The Advantages of Cloud Computing for Financial Firms?

In an era where digital transformation is redefining every industry, financial firms are increasingly reliant on advanced technologies to stay competitive. Among these, cloud computing stands out as a pivotal development. Embracing cloud solutions enables these firms to streamline operations, offer innovative services, and enhance customer experience. But what specific advantages does cloud computing provide to the financial sector? Read on to discover how cloud infrastructure empowers financial firms and why it is an essential component of their digital strategy.

Enhanced Data Security and Compliance

Data security is paramount for financial institutions given the sensitive nature of the information they handle. Cloud computing provides advanced encryption techniques and robust security protocols that are often more comprehensive than what individual companies can deploy on their own. Leading cloud service providers offer secure frameworks compliant with various regulations such as GDPR, PCI DSS, and others tailored for specific jurisdictions. Furthermore, features like automatic software updates ensure that security measures are always up-to-date, aiding financial firms in maintaining compliance effortlessly.

Scalability and Flexibility

Financial operations fluctuate, influenced by factors such as market trends and customer demand. Cloud computing offers unparalleled scalability, enabling firms to quickly adjust their infrastructure to meet changing demands. Whether scaling up during tax season or downscaling during quieter periods, cloud solutions allow financial firms to maintain high efficiency without the need for significant upfront investments in hardware. This scaling flexibility not only optimizes operation costs but also accelerates the time to market for new financial services and products.

Cost Efficiency

Traditional IT infrastructure can be expensive and resource-intensive, requiring substantial capital investment and ongoing maintenance. Cloud computing allows financial firms to transition from a capital expenses model to an operational expenses model. By paying for only the resources they use, firms significantly reduce costs related to infrastructure management. Furthermore, the shared infrastructure model of the cloud cuts down on redundancies and enables financial companies to exploit economies of scale – benefits that are often passed on to the end customer.

Business Continuity and Disaster Recovery

In the financial world, unplanned downtime can translate into substantial financial loss and reputational damage. Cloud computing strengthens business continuity plans by providing reliable disaster recovery solutions that ensure data is backed up and can be recovered quickly and efficiently. Leading cloud providers offer multiple interconnected data centers to mirror data and applications, providing assurance that financial firms can continue operations seamlessly, even in the event of localized outages or disasters.

Innovation and Agility

Financial firms leveraging cloud computing can rapidly deploy new technologies and solutions, thus fostering a culture of innovation. From artificial intelligence and machine learning to analytics and blockchain, the cloud provides the necessary infrastructure to experiment and implement cutting-edge solutions. This infusion of technological agility fuels the development of innovative financial products, enhances customer engagement, and drives new business models. In this fiercely competitive market, the ability to innovate quickly is a significant differentiator.

Enhanced Collaboration and Mobility

With cloud computing, employees within financial firms can collaborate more efficiently and work remotely with ease. Cloud solutions offer access to data and applications from any location, enabling seamless integration of geographically diverse teams. Enhanced collaboration tools encourage productivity and ensure that all team members have the necessary resources and information at their fingertips. Mobility is another advantage – financial advisors and customer service representatives can engage with clients or access critical data even while on the go, improving service delivery and client satisfaction.

Environmental Benefits

In addition to operational advantages, cloud computing also contributes to the sustainability efforts of financial firms. By reducing the need for physical hardware and optimizing energy use, cloud solutions can minimize the carbon footprint of financial operations. Cloud providers often operate at energy-efficient data centers run on renewable energy. Transitioning to the cloud thus aligns financial firms with green initiatives and improves their corporate social responsibility profile, which is increasingly important to investors and customers alike.

Improved Customer Experience

Ultimately, cloud computing empowers financial firms to deliver superior customer experiences. Faster processing times, personalized services, and continuous availability are attributes that distinguish leading firms from the rest. Cloud-based analytics and artificial intelligence allow for real-time insights that financial firms can use to anticipate client needs and tailor offerings accordingly. Personalization and enhanced client interactions not only increase customer satisfaction but also foster loyalty in a market where clients have numerous options.

Conclusion

The adoption of cloud computing in the financial sector is not merely a trend but a strategic initiative that offers numerous advantages. From enhanced security and reduced costs to improved agility and customer satisfaction, cloud solutions provide financial firms with the tools necessary to navigate an increasingly complex landscape. As financial institutions continue their journey of digital transformation, the benefits of cloud computing will undoubtedly play a central role in shaping the future of the industry. Embracing the cloud is not just about modernizing IT infrastructure; it’s about ensuring competitiveness and growth in the digital age.
